Despite the fact that researchers were aware of the analgesic effects of comparable compounds, it hadn't Earlier been probable to analyze conolidine, mainly because there wasn't sufficient in the compound readily available with the pure resource for testing. It can make up just 0.00014% with the bark of T. divaricata.

Conolidine is present in the bark in the tropical flowering shrub Tabernaemontana divaricata, usually called the pinwheel flower. The plant is native to southeast Asia, where by it's got extensive been used in classic Chinese, Ayurvedic and Thai medicines to deal with fever and pain.
